概括
一种名为LINDA (使用转录学和差分拼接数据分析进行网络重建的线性整数编程) 的新方法分析了RNA拼接对蛋白质相互作用的影响. 林达提高了对细胞通路和调节网络的理解.
科学领域:
- 分子生物学分子生物学
- 生物信息学是一种生物信息学.
- 系统生物学 系统生物学
背景情况:
- 替代RNA拼接显著影响蛋白质功能和细胞通路.
- 现有的工具缺乏对拼接对蛋白质-蛋白质相互作用的影响的机械特征.
- 了解依赖拼接的网络变化对于破译生物复杂性至关重要.
研究的目的:
- 引入线性整数编程用于使用转录学和差分拼接数据分析 (LINDA) 的网络重建,这是一种新的计算方法.
- 整合各种生物数据,包括蛋白质-蛋白质相互作用,域-域相互作用,转录因子目标和差异拼接数据.
- 推断和分析对细胞通路和调节网络的依赖拼接效应.
主要方法:
- LINDA 是使用线性整数编程来重建生物网络而开发的.
- 该方法整合了蛋白质-蛋白质相互作用数据库,域-域相互作用数据和转录因子目标信息.
- 结合了差分拼接和转录分析数据,以确定拼接特定的网络变化.
主要成果:
- 在HepG2和K562细胞中,LINDA应用于54个shRNA枯竭实验.
- 计算基准测试表明,与忽视拼接的方法相比,LINDA在识别路径机制方面的优越能力更高.
- 实验验证证证实了HNRNPK枯竭对K562细胞信号通路的预测拼接效应.
结论:
- 林达提供了一种强有力的方法来机械地描述拼接在蛋白质相互作用网络中的作用.
- 拼接数据的整合提高了路径和监管网络重建的准确性.
- 这种方法为细胞过程中替代RNA剪接的功能后果提供了新的见解.

RNA Splicing
Splicing is the process by which eukaryotic RNA is edited before its translation into protein. The RNA strand transcribed from eukaryotic DNA is called the primary transcript. The primary transcripts that become mRNAs are called precursor messenger RNAs (pre-mRNAs). Eukaryotic pre-mRNA contains alternating sequences of exons and introns. Protein Networks
An organism can have thousands of different proteins, and these proteins must cooperate to ensure the health of an organism. Proteins bind to other proteins and form complexes to carry out their functions. Many proteins interact with multiple other proteins creating a complex network of protein interactions.

Alternative RNA Splicing
Alternative RNA splicing is the regulated splicing of exons and introns to produce different mature mRNAs from a single pre-mRNA. Unlike in constitutive splicing where a single gene produces a single type of mRNA, alternative splicing allows an organism to produce multiple proteins from a single gene and plays an important role in protein diversity.
